Output e7f947e982f21fe7a80a83a8d345354d8f30673526c63e62eb913c4c1ece17e6:0

value
15614518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7f2898f2bc34fd92e9656f43d578095379d59a OP_EQUAL
address
M9Dp2FQFQBNeyD6WRackWvRRVqNVwUYyEw
transaction
e7f947e982f21fe7a80a83a8d345354d8f30673526c63e62eb913c4c1ece17e6
spent
true